Lê, Dinh Q. (Vietnamese conceptual artist, 1968-2024)
|
Note: Vietnamese-American artist explored the trauma wrought by the Vietnam War in his multimedia works. Following the 1978 invasion of Vietnam by Cambodia’s Khmer Rouge, Lê and his family escaped and eventually settled in Los Angeles, California. He earned a BFA from the University of California, Santa Barbara, and his MFA from New York’s School of Visual Arts. He returned permanently to Vietnam in the 1990s. |
